The correlation between historical prices or returns on Rationalpier 88 Conv and Lord Abbett is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Lord Abbett Government are associated (or correlated) with Rational/pier.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Rationalpier 88 Conv has no effect on the direction of Lord Abbett i.e., Lord Abbett and Rational/pier go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Lord Abbett and Rational/pier
The main advantage of trading using opposite Lord Abbett and Rational/pier posit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Lord Abbett position performs unexpectedly, Rational/pier can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
